Aidan Hutchinson, Detroit Lions Finally Agree to Huge 4-Year Contract Extension
Hutchinson, with 6 sacks in 7 games, is the eighth core Lion to sign an extension as Detroit invests $788.5 million in key players since spring 2024.
- Aidan Hutchinson, a defensive end for the Detroit Lions, agreed to a 4-year, $180 million contract extension with $141 million guaranteed.
- Hutchinson, 25, was the NFL Defensive Rookie of the Year runner-up in 2022 and made the Pro Bowl in 2023 with 11.5 sacks.
- The Lions' rise has coincided with Hutchinson's arrival, going from 17-46-2 in the 4 seasons before him to 41-17 in his 4 seasons.
